‘April’ Takes Double Win at Asia Pacific Screen Awards

Georgian drama film “April” took double honors on Saturday at the annual Asia Pacific Screen Awards, winning the best film prize and the best performance prize for Ia Sukhitashvili. Directed by Dea Kulumbegashvili, the film portrays the determination of an obstetrics and gynaecology provider in the face of accusations about the death of a newborn […]

Hit Netflix Series Gets Ready for Graduation in Season 3

Netflix‘s wildly popular Australian teen series Heartbreak High is getting ready for graduation. The show’s producers revealed last week that shooting has officially begun on the third and final season of the hit high school comedy-drama.
